I am a Brazilian born artist based in Virginia, USA, and I create semi-abstract watercolor and acrylic artworks. My practice explores ambiguity and contradiction through the interplay of lines and textures within organic-like forms.
I think of people, places, and moments, and I let my body become a vessel for paint to pass through.
My process is an attempt to return to my free, wild self. I carry traces of repression, delay, and resistance as I walk back into places once called home. In flora and fauna I encounter familiar forms, and finally, I feel that I belong.
I studied agronomy and marketing, and I experimented with several forms of art until I had an epiphany. I did not find art, it had always been there—a quiet impulse waiting to be remembered, and following it felt like surrendering to a voice I had long trained myself not to hear.
